What Are Payday Loans in Fort McMurray?

A payday loan is a short-term borrowing option that lets you access cash quickly, usually between $100 and $1,500, to cover an unexpected expense before your next paycheque arrives. In Fort McMurray, where earnings can shift between pay periods due to the nature of oil sands work, this type of loan is commonly used to bridge gaps caused by surprise vehicle repairs, urgent household costs, or bills that simply cannot wait until the next deposit hits.

These loans are regulated in Alberta under the province's Consumer Protection Act, which caps borrowing costs at $14 per $100 and requires lenders to be fully licensed. Unlike traditional lump-sum options that require full repayment on your next payday, some lenders, including iCash, offer an installment repayment structure.

That means you can spread your repayment across two to seven payments rather than paying everything back at once. The entire process happens online, so there is no need to visit a branch or office.

Cost of Payday Loans in Alberta

The cost of borrowing is straightforward: $14 for every $100 borrowed. That is a flat fee per loan, not a compounding interest rate.

Here is a practical example: if you borrow $300, the total fee is $42 (300 / 100 x 14). Your total repayment would be $342, split across your scheduled installments.

Financial Realities in Fort McMurray — What Locals Face

Fort McMurray's median household earnings sit at $138,000, well above the provincial and national averages (Statistics Canada, Census Profile 2021). But that headline number doesn't tell the full story.

The local economy runs on oil sands operations, where boom-bust cycles, seasonal shutdowns, and contract work create gaps that do not line up with when bills are due.

As of early 2026:

  • Average apartment rent sits at approximately $1,600 per month.

  • Groceries for an average family run about $580 per month, higher than most Alberta cities due to the remote northern location.

  • Most residents rely on personal vehicles, though Fort McMurray Transit offers a monthly adult pass at $76.

  • Wildfire recovery costs continue to affect household budgets, adding pressure that other Alberta cities do not face.

Borrow Responsibly

A short-term loan works best when it is used as a temporary solution, not a long-term habit. Before you borrow, take a few minutes to explore your options and make sure this is the right move for your situation.

Only borrow what you can comfortably repay. Look at your upcoming paycheque and subtract your fixed expenses like rent, utilities, and groceries. The amount left over is your realistic repayment budget. If the repayment would stretch that too thin, consider borrowing a smaller amount.

Know your repayment schedule before you sign. Payments are collected automatically through pre-authorized debits on the dates outlined in your agreement. In Alberta, repayments can be split across up to three installments, so review each date and amount to make sure they line up with your pay periods.

Use the 5-day grace period if you need it. If a scheduled payment cannot be processed on the expected date, we provide a 5-day buffer. And if your paycheque is delayed or your schedule changes, reach out to our customer support team as early as possible. The sooner you communicate, the more options you have.
